    My SMA is about to expire and at a cost of over $3200.00 to do so I am wondering what are the pros an cons of should I not re-new at this time.

    Guess what I am asking is any one ever had any major issues by not re-newing? My employer has asked me to justify the cost before he will shell out the cash...

  • #2
    We haven't in probably five years. It all depends on what you need. Problem is when / if you do decide to, they backcharge for all the years you didn't upgrade.

      What version are at right now?

      It could become an issue down the road if you use CAD a lot and/or you load or send programs to/from customers.

      If you are at 3.7mr3 or 4.2 you could be alright to not renew, but keep in mind if you don't renew now and you want to upgrade later, you will pay $$$ for the time you didn't keep the SMA current.

            Right, so this year it is $3200 and if you decide next year to sign up again (maybe you need the tech support or want to upgrade the software) they will hit you for $6400. We keep our sma up to date b/c when I started we were past due. The boss wanted to upgrade and I wanted an upgrade. It was at 3.2 something when I started. So, we were several years past due. He pays it yearly now b/c it is easier to get $3200 a year from the $ guys than to pry out the $16,000 we needed to bring us up to date.

                      You should be able to download and use any version that has/had a release date prior to the expiration date stored on your portlock. It shouldn't matter if you download it before or after the expiration date.
